{{other people|Gillian Chan}} {{short description|Canadian children's author|bot=PearBOT 5}} {{BLP sources|date=April 2014}} {{Infobox writer <!-- for more information see [[:Template:Infobox writer/doc]] --> | name = Gillian Chan | image = | caption = | birth_date = 1954 | death_date = | spouse = | occupation = author | genre = children's literature | website = {{URL|http://www.gillianchan.com/}} }} '''Gillian Chan''' (born 1954) is a [[Canadians|Canadian]] [[children's author]] who lives in [[Dundas, Ontario]]. She was educated at [[Mill Hill County High School|Orange Hill Grammar School]] and the [[University of East Anglia]] (BEd, 1980). Chan is also the author of a short diary entry of Chin Mei-ling's during the Christmas week a year or so after the original diary ended for the Christmas treasury from the [[Dear Canada series]], ''A Season for Miracles: Twelve Tales of Christmas.''
